What affects the price

Wildlife removal costs aren't one-size-fits-all because every situation involves different variables. When we assess your property, we look at the type of animal causing the trouble, how many entry points they have created, and the total square footage that needs securing. If an animal has caused damage to insulation or wiring, or if we need to set up multi-day trapping cycles, those factors will naturally shift the total. Summer heat drives animals to find cool, dark places, often leading them into sheds, crawlspaces, or under decks. This is also when young animals begin exploring and can accidentally get trapped inside your home. What is the 3-3-3 rule for rehoming dogs?

The 3-3-3 rule outlines the typical adjustment period for a new dog: three days for decompression, three weeks to learn routines, and three months to feel truly settled. This helps pet owners in Hialeah manage expectations for their new companions.
